Output caa520f673c889573b68118a27f4ae71e5eed5404626ae9a5d8c3eec406f6336:0

value
251498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f7b37fffd680def4dd77f1875124cc6882bc23 OP_EQUAL
address
3Dp5rSjbJnEDx1BD6P2RyhJqH86NGPtNsH
transaction
caa520f673c889573b68118a27f4ae71e5eed5404626ae9a5d8c3eec406f6336
spent
true